Introduction

Affordable daycare is becoming a pressing concern for households across the country, given that price of childcare consistently rise. With an increase of parents entering the staff and needing dependable care for kids, the option of inexpensive daycare is becoming an important element in deciding the economic security of many people. This observational study is designed to explore the effect of affordable daycare on households, emphasizing the benefits and challenges that are included with use of high quality, affordable childcare.

Methodology

With this study, observational study methods had been utilized to assemble information regarding the experiences of families with inexpensive daycare. A sample of 50 households was selected from different socio-economic backgrounds, with a range of childcare needs and preferences. Participants were interviewed about their experiences with affordable daycare, like the prices, quality of care, and total effect on their family characteristics. Observations had been also made at daycare facilities to assess the quality of care provided and communications between children, caregivers, and moms and dads.

Results

The outcome of this research revealed a selection of advantages and challenges connected with inexpensive daycare. Households stated that usage of inexpensive childcare allowed all of them to exert effort full-time, pursue higher education, or take in additional duties without fretting about the cost of care. Many parents additionally noted that their children benefited from the socialization and academic options provided by daycare facilities, which aided all of them develop crucial skills and get ready for school.

However, challenges were additionally reported, including minimal option of affordable daycare in some areas, long waitlists for high quality facilities, and concerns towards quality of treatment offered. Some families noted they must make sacrifices in other regions of their particular budget to cover childcare, while others expressed frustration using not enough mobility in daycare hours and/or lack of social or language-specific programs due to their young ones.

In general, the influence of inexpensive daycare on people was largely positive, with many parents revealing appreciation the support and resources given by childcare facilities. However, there is nonetheless a need to get more affordable choices and better availability for people looking for quality look after their children.
